How Bootstrapped Founders Use Annual Contracts to Lock in Cash Flow
from The Bootstrapped Tech Founder with Fexingo: Profitable Software Companies Without VC · host Fexingo
Episode 59 of The Bootstrapped Tech Founder digs into why more indie software companies are switching to annual contracts — and what happens when they do. Lucas and Luna break down the cash-flow math behind pre-collected revenue, using real examples like a solo founder who boosted operating runway by 11 months overnight. They explore the psychological shift for both founder and customer, the churn trade-offs, and why annual billing can be a discipline tool for product focus.
